ErSbO4 is a rare-earth antimonate ceramic compound containing erbium and antimony oxides, representing a functional ceramic material from the lanthanide oxysalt family. This material is primarily investigated in research contexts for its potential in optoelectronic and photonic applications, as erbium-doped ceramics are known for luminescent properties and potential use in fiber amplifiers and laser systems. While not yet widely deployed in mainstream industrial production, erbium antimonates are of academic and specialized interest for their refractory characteristics and potential in radiation-resistant or high-temperature ceramic composites.
